“There’s always something bigger behind whatever you’re doing.” American Idol’s Jason Castro came to a reality of his own that having a relationship with God didn’t mean he had to conform to religious servitude.
Music became a channel of release and in this discovery he found that it had the power to calm, to move or evoke emotions of any kind. He brought his talent to life by recognizing his love for something bigger and his passion to make not only religious music, but good music. A dear hobby and a mission to find the rhyme and reason of life became something much more than he ever imagined. As he memoirs his journey, the medley Somewhere Over the Rainbow comes to mind and he sings the message about dreams. That if you dare to dream, it will come true.
